Sweet Honey Scrub Recipe

We're past the holidays and welcome in the year 2013, with hopes and resolutions anew. However, if your skin is feeling and looking a little dull from lack of attention during this busy time of the year, here's an easy scrub you can mix up in about 2 minutes.

To soften stubborn dry patches on rough elbows and knees, opt for a rich, hydrating scrub. "I use a simple mix of honey and sugar," says Ford makeup artist Lisa Trunda. Studies show that humectant honey reduces inflammation, and sugar (applied topically) increases circulation in skin, says Miami dermatologist Jeremy Green, M.D. 

"This can be especially helpful in winter when blood flow is typically diverted from the skin to keep your core warm."
 
Try equal parts honey to sugar. You may want to add a tablespoon of coconut oil (warmed slightly) to amp up the deep, moisturizing capabilities of this simple but effective skin exfoliator.
 
PS: salt works well, too.
